Blues striker in fitness race

McFadden was substituted during last weekend's win over Wigan with a groin injury after scoring the decisive goal from the penalty spot.He joined up with Scotland after the weekend but was forced to withdraw from the side to face the Czech Republic - the first game of the Craig Levein era.Blues boss Alex McLeish said: "It is unusual that James would run off the pitch willingly like he did last weekend without throwing a tantrum."He likes to show his displeasure when we take him off with even a minute to go. We keep saying to the players, it is about the bigger picture, about the team, it's about the squad and sometimes it is about taking a guy off who is not at his best."But normally it's because of changing things legs-wise and getting freshness onto the pitch. When he ran off willingly last week I said 'it's not like McFadden' and I seriously worried about his chances of playing for Scotland."
